The phrase refers to optimal destinations across Europe for travel during the ninth month of the year. These cities offer desirable conditions based on factors such as climate, cultural events, and tourist density. For example, a location with mild weather, fewer crowds than peak summer, and seasonal festivals would be considered a prime candidate.
Choosing appropriate locales for this specific period provides several advantages. Travelers can experience reduced accommodation costs and flight prices compared to the high season. Moreover, the lessened congestion at popular attractions enhances the overall visit. Historically, September has represented a transitional period, offering a balance between the summer rush and the pre-holiday lull, resulting in a more relaxed and authentic travel experience.
